如何利用 Xray-install 实现一键升级:版本管理和预发布版本安装

张开发
2026/5/17 21:06:36 15 分钟阅读
如何利用 Xray-install 实现一键升级:版本管理和预发布版本安装
如何利用 Xray-install 实现一键升级版本管理和预发布版本安装【免费下载链接】Xray-installEasiest way to install upgrade Xray项目地址: https://gitcode.com/gh_mirrors/xra/Xray-installXray-install 是一款简单高效的 Xray 安装与升级工具它提供了便捷的版本管理功能让用户能够轻松实现一键升级和预发布版本的安装。本文将详细介绍如何使用 Xray-install 进行版本管理和预发布版本的安装。版本管理功能概述Xray-install 提供了丰富的版本管理功能包括查看当前版本、获取最新版本信息以及安装指定版本等。这些功能主要通过install-release.sh脚本实现。查看当前版本要查看当前安装的 Xray 版本可以使用以下命令./install-release.sh --version获取最新版本信息Xray-install 能够自动获取最新的 Xray 版本信息。脚本中定义了三个版本变量CURRENT_VERSION当前安装的 Xray 版本RELEASE_LATEST最新的稳定版版本PRE_RELEASE_LATEST最新的预发布/发布版本这些变量在脚本的第 37-46 行中定义用于跟踪和比较不同版本。一键升级的实现方法Xray-install 提供了简单的一键升级功能让用户能够轻松将 Xray 更新到最新版本。升级到最新稳定版要升级到最新的稳定版只需运行以下命令./install-release.sh脚本会自动检查当前版本和最新版本如果有新版本可用将进行自动升级。强制升级如果需要强制安装相同版本可以使用--force参数./install-release.sh --force这个参数在脚本的第 808 行有详细说明表示即使版本相同也强制安装。预发布版本的安装方法对于想要体验最新功能的用户Xray-install 提供了安装预发布版本的选项。安装最新预发布版本要安装最新的预发布版本可以使用--beta参数./install-release.sh --beta脚本会检查是否存在预发布版本并安装最新的一个。如脚本第 737 行所示它会显示最新的预发布/发布版本信息。安装指定版本如果需要安装特定的版本可以使用--version参数./install-release.sh --version v1.0.0其中v1.0.0是你想要安装的具体版本号。这个功能在脚本的第 807 行有详细说明。版本控制的高级选项Xray-install 还提供了一些高级的版本控制选项满足不同用户的需求。重新安装当前版本如果你需要重新安装当前版本可以使用--reinstall参数./install-release.sh --reinstall这个选项在脚本的第 813 行有说明适用于修复可能的安装问题。通过代理检查新版本如果你的网络环境需要代理可以使用-p或--proxy参数./install-release.sh --proxy这个选项允许脚本通过代理服务器检查新版本在脚本的第 824 行有详细说明。版本兼容性检查Xray-install 还包含版本兼容性检查功能确保安装的版本与系统兼容。脚本中定义了version_gt函数用于比较版本号的大小。这个函数在进行版本升级时会被调用确保安装的版本是较新的。此外脚本还会检查系统的 systemd 版本如果版本过低会给出警告信息如脚本第 112-113 行所示。通过以上功能Xray-install 为用户提供了全面的版本管理解决方案无论是普通用户还是开发者都能轻松实现 Xray 的安装和升级。无论是稳定版还是预发布版Xray-install 都能满足你的需求让你始终使用到最新、最稳定的 Xray 版本。【免费下载链接】Xray-installEasiest way to install upgrade Xray项目地址: https://gitcode.com/gh_mirrors/xra/Xray-install创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章